Web1 jul. 1991 · Computed tomography (CT) is clearly more sensitive than chest radiography or conventional linear tomography in the detection of pulmonary metastases. Routine chest CT scans may reveal peripheral nodules as small as 2-3 mm, and high-resolution CT may demonstrate lymphangitic carcinomatosis.
